Port Blair, Nov. 6: Central Agricultural Research Institute, Port Blair organized the “Vigilance Awareness Week” from 29th October to 3rd November 2012, wherein events / programme like taking pledge, lecture on “Determination of vigilance angle in public procurement and Office Administration”, essay and debate competition was conducted. Beside workshop on “Right to Information Act and its impact in bringing about transparency in the working of Public Institutions” was also organized which was coordinated by Dr. M. Shankaran (Sr. Scientist). Dr. S. Dam Roy, Director CARI during the valedictory function on 5th November, 2012 stressed to maintain discipline and transparency in the work by all staff members of the Institute. He also distributed certificates and prizes to the participants and winners of essay and debate competition. Earlier Dr D.R. Singh, Vigilance Officer, CARI welcome the gathering and gave an overview of vigilance programme and vote of thanks was proposed by Dr. A. K. Singh, Coordinator.
